Anomaly 102 Ski delivers powerful stability and freeride versatility for aggressive resort laps
What Our Gearhead Experts Are Saying:
''The Anomaly 102 feels like the perfect balance between Blizzard’s Cochise and Bonafide. It charges hard with the stability of metal underfoot but still pivots quickly when I need to. It’s powerful, damp, and confidence-inspiring both on groomers and in softer snow.''
Who It’s For
Advanced to Expert Freeride Skiers:
The Anomaly 102 is built for aggressive skiers who want one ski to carve hard on groomers and blast through chop or powder stashes. It’s ideal for those who value stability at speed, confident edge hold, and freeride capability without sacrificing control.
What It’s For
Resort Freeride and All-Mountain Charging:
With a 102mm waist, camber underfoot, and rocker at the tip and tail, the Anomaly 102 thrives in mixed conditions. It’s built for skiers who want stability for high-speed arcs, power in chopped snow, and the maneuverability to dip into soft terrain between storms.
Why We Like It
Confidence at Speed, Power in All Conditions:
We like the Anomaly 102 because it blends Blizzard’s trademark metal-powered dampness with freeride versatility. The TrueBlend wood core and dual titanal laminates keep it stable and responsive, while the rocker profile provides float and easy pivoting. It’s a ski that lets us ski fast, hard, and in control everywhere.
